Deen Freelon is an associate professor at the University of North Carolina Hussman School of Journalism and Media, where he works on data science and political expression in social media. Here, he speaks with
Lawfare‘s Evelyn Douek and Quinta Jurecic about the interaction of race and disinformation and about the effectiveness of Russia’s Internet Research Agency.
